I have a pandora charm bracelet. I have a bracelet that has spacers dividing it into 3 sections. The middle section has the first letter of our last name and 3 charms that represent me. Then each of the boys have a section that represents them with thier initials. I also have their birthstones in their sections. Each boy also has one charm that relates to them. My older boy has the turtle because it was one of his first real words. My youngest has the horseshoe for his cowboy nursery.

I love my bracelet, it represents my two greatest loves yet it is very stylish. All of my beads are sterling silver. It can get pretty expensive to fill the bracelet though. I know my husband has already spent over $250 and I still have a lot of empty space on it.
